What Is the Inflammatory Cascade?

The inflammatory cascade is a complex, multi-step immune response triggered by injury, infection, stress, or toxins. It begins with a simple signal—often damage to a tissue or cell—and unfolds through a series of escalating immune reactions.

This process involves:

  • Cytokine release (messenger proteins like IL-6, TNF-α)

  • White blood cell activation

  • Increased vascular permeability

  • Production of reactive oxygen species (ROS)

  • Upregulation of inflammatory enzymes like COX-2 and NF-kB

These steps are necessary for healing and defense—but when they’re overactive or prolonged, the same cascade that was meant to protect can begin to damage tissues and disrupt cellular function.


Acute vs. Chronic Inflammation

  • Acute inflammation is short-term and beneficial (e.g., after a cut or infection).

  • Chronic inflammation is low-grade, persistent, and often invisible—causing long-term damage without obvious symptoms.

This chronic inflammatory state is now linked to a wide range of conditions, including:

  • Cognitive decline & neurodegeneration

  • Cardiovascular disease

  • Autoimmune disorders

  • Metabolic syndrome & insulin resistance

  • Depression & mood imbalances

  • Gut dysfunction & leaky gut

The inflammatory cascade is often already underway before symptoms show up—which is why early intervention is critical.
